Description

溶剂型环氧涂料混合罐高效清洗方法Efficient cleaning method for solvent-based epoxy paint mixing tank

技术领域 technical field

本发明属于清洗技术领域,具体涉及溶剂型环氧涂料混合罐高效清洗方法。 The invention belongs to the technical field of cleaning, and in particular relates to an efficient cleaning method for a solvent-based epoxy paint mixing tank.

背景技术 Background technique

溶剂型环氧涂料混合罐清洗方法一般采用铲刀,刷子,配合稀释剂进行清洗罐壁涂料,员工工作强度大,工作效率低,清洗不彻底,而且影响员工健康。 The cleaning method of solvent-based epoxy paint mixing tanks generally uses spatulas, brushes, and thinners to clean the tank wall coatings. The employees' work intensity is high, the work efficiency is low, the cleaning is not thorough, and it affects the health of employees.

发明内容 Contents of the invention

本发明所要解决的技术问题是提供一种简单高效,安全可靠的溶剂型环氧涂料混合罐高效清洗方法。 The technical problem to be solved by the present invention is to provide a simple, efficient, safe and reliable solvent-based epoxy paint mixing tank efficient cleaning method.

为解决上述技术问题,本发明采用的技术方案是: In order to solve the problems of the technologies described above, the technical solution adopted in the present invention is:

溶剂型环氧涂料混合罐高效清洗方法,包括以下步骤: An efficient cleaning method for solvent-based epoxy paint mixing tanks, comprising the following steps:

(1)将以下质量百分比的各组分充分搅拌混合配制成清洗液: 45-55%二甲苯、20-30%甲基异丁基酮和20-30%异丁醇; (1) Fully stir and mix the following components by mass percentage to prepare a cleaning solution: 45-55% xylene, 20-30% methyl isobutyl ketone and 20-30% isobutanol;

(2)采用高压无气喷枪将步骤(1)制得的清洗液喷涂在混合罐的罐壁,快速溶解和冲刷粘附在罐壁的涂料,该高压无气喷枪的压力比控制在40:1-50:1,其枪嘴的扇面半径控制在48-52mm、孔径控制在0.28-0.32mm; (2) Use a high-pressure airless spray gun to spray the cleaning solution prepared in step (1) on the tank wall of the mixing tank to quickly dissolve and wash away the coating adhered to the tank wall. The pressure ratio of the high-pressure airless spray gun is controlled at 40: 1-50:1, the fan radius of the nozzle is controlled at 48-52mm, and the aperture is controlled at 0.28-0.32mm;

(3)打开罐底阀门,放出涂料与清洗液的混合物。 (3) Open the valve at the bottom of the tank to release the mixture of paint and cleaning fluid.

优选的,上述步骤(1)中,将以下质量百分比的各组分充分搅拌混合配制成清洗液:50%二甲苯、25%甲基异丁基酮和25%异丁醇。 Preferably, in the above step (1), the following mass percentage components are fully stirred and mixed to prepare a cleaning solution: 50% xylene, 25% methyl isobutyl ketone and 25% isobutanol.

与现有技术相比,本发明的优点是:本方法通过高压无气喷枪配合高效清洗液冲刷罐壁附着的涂料,操作简单,清洗效率高,较传统方法能节省70%以上的时间;同时,配置的清洗液具有很强的溶解环氧漆的能力,且具有适宜的电阻率,可以在高流速时不会发生静电而引起火灾,安全可靠。  Compared with the prior art, the advantages of the present invention are: the method uses a high-pressure airless spray gun to cooperate with a high-efficiency cleaning liquid to flush the paint attached to the tank wall, which is simple to operate and high in cleaning efficiency, and can save more than 70% of the time compared with the traditional method; at the same time , The configured cleaning solution has a strong ability to dissolve epoxy paint, and has a suitable resistivity, which can prevent fires caused by static electricity at high flow rates, and is safe and reliable. the

上述各实施例制得的清洗液的电阻率约为1.5*106Ωkm。 The resistivity of the cleaning solution prepared in the above examples is about 1.5*10 6 Ωkm.

上述各实施例在清洗8000L的溶剂型环氧涂料混合罐时,清洗时间为12-15min,而采用传统方法需要60-70min,大大节省了人力和物力。 When cleaning the 8000L solvent-based epoxy paint mixing tank in the above-mentioned embodiments, the cleaning time is 12-15 minutes, while the traditional method takes 60-70 minutes, which greatly saves manpower and material resources.
